Getting there

Florence (Peretola) Airport (FLR)

45-60 minutes by car to venue

Rental car

€40-80 daily rental

45 minutes from FLR · Drive south from Florence toward Siena; most flexible for guest transport throughout the region

Private transfer service

€100-150 per vehicle (shared or private)

60 minutes door-to-door · Arrange through the hotel for guaranteed transportation from airport to venue

Train + taxi

€15-25 train + €30-50 taxi

90+ minutes total · Florence Centrale train station to venue area; less convenient but budget-friendly

Cost estimate

Ceremony / venue fee

Contact venue—typically €500-1,500 depending on setup

Reception (per guest)

€50-90 per person (3-course menu, beverages, service)

Accommodation (per night)

€80-150 per room based on season and occupancy

Estimated total

€8,000-25,000+ for 50 guests (2-night event including rooms and catering)

Estimate assumes 50 guests, 2 nights accommodation, 3-course dinner, and basic ceremony setup. Final pricing requires direct quote from venue. Off-season (November-March) typically 20-30% less expensive.

Frequently asked questions

Can all our guests stay at the venue?
La Locanda di Pietracupa has 31 rooms available. For weddings exceeding this capacity, the venue can recommend partner accommodations in nearby towns within 15-20 minutes.
What's included in a wedding package?
Contact the venue directly through their website (locandapietracupa.it) to discuss catering, ceremony setup, reception space, and guest room rates. Packages typically vary based on season and group size.
Are there outdoor ceremony options?
As a countryside hotel property, outdoor spaces exist on the grounds. Specific setup options depend on weather contingencies and seasonal conditions—discuss with the venue coordinator during consultation.
How far is this from Florence?
Madonna di Pietracupa is approximately 30-35 kilometers south of Florence, roughly 45 minutes by car, making day trips or pre-wedding festivities in the city feasible.
What's the best time to marry here?
Spring (April-May) and fall (September-October) offer ideal weather. Summer brings heat; winter requires indoor planning. Availability varies—book 6-12 months ahead for peak seasons.
